When I was little I was absolutely obsessed with Nature Print Sun-Sensitive Paper. If you’ve never used it before, it’s a sunlight print where you place objects on top and once exposed to the light, it leaves the design of your objects. Using items or shapes that are specific to your wedding/party theme – arrange them on this paper, put in the sun and get excited to have made one of the most unique table number ideas online!
Working in a place in your home that isn’t in direct sunlight, remove the Nature Print Sun-Sensitive Paper from it’s black sleeve. Place onto a piece of cardboard and stabilize using a simple sewing pin. Then start creating your design with any found objects you have. Here I pinned fern leaves to the cardboard to hold them in place and then used Alphabet & Number Sponges as the table numbers!
Expose! Take your board outside and expose your design to direct sunlight for 30-60 seconds or until you see the paper turn a very light blue. Keep in mind that shadows will show up and so will slight movements or direction change so keep still while exposing.
Carefully remove your found items and rinse your paper to set the design. You will see some blue transfer rinse off and reveal your sun print, the blue actually changes to white – it’s super cool. If you don’t do this step the design will fade away! Lay the paper flat to dry.
Quickly iron to smooth.
Frame your print!
